Importance of Radiation Proctitis Specialist in Treatment
Radiation proctitis is inflammation of the rectum lining following radiation therapy, leading to pain and bleeding. Early treatment with medications and laser therapy can relieve symptoms and prevent complications.

Early indicators of Radiation Proctitis include rectal bleeding, diarrhea, urgency, and abdominal pain. Monitoring symptoms is crucial for timely intervention and management.
Radiation proctitis can be managed effectively by using medications such as anti-inflammatory drugs and topical agents. Patients may also benefit from dietary modifications, fiber supplements, and avoiding irritants.
Radiation Proctitis commonly co-exists with conditions such as rectal bleeding, diarrhea, pain, and inflammation in the rectum. Managing these symptoms is crucial for patients with Radiation Proctitis.
Standard treatment options for Radiation Proctitis include medications to manage symptoms, dietary modifications, hyperbaric oxygen therapy, and in severe cases, endoscopic interventions. Close monitoring by a healthcare provider is crucial.
